Brian Crombie: Ex-Husband of Bonnie Crombie Running for Mississauga Mayor

The Crombie name will once again appear on the ballot in Mississauga’s upcoming mayoral race. Brian Crombie, the ex-husband of former Mississauga mayor Bonnie Crombie, has officially registered as a candidate, adding his name to the growing list of contenders in the highly anticipated byelection.

Brian Crombie Enters the Mississauga Mayoral Race

On Wednesday, Brian Crombie became the 20th candidate to enter the race, confirming his bid for mayor of Mississauga. In his official statement, he emphasized his commitment to addressing key issues in the city.

“As a longtime resident, businessperson, and community advocate, I am deeply concerned about the future of our city. We have many crises we face: affordability, congestion, crime, and lack of vision.”

Crombie is no stranger to public service and business leadership. He has served as the president of the Mississauga Arts Council and has a long history in corporate finance and strategy. Additionally, he is the host of a talk show on Sauga 960 AM, where he discusses political and social issues impacting the community.

Political and Business Background

Brian Crombie’s political involvement extends beyond the municipal level. In 2022, he ran in the provincial election under the None of the Above Party in Mississauga—Lakeshore, though he received only about 450 votes. Despite this, his dedication to civic engagement remains evident.

In the corporate world, Crombie held executive roles in various industries, including biotech and finance. However, his career faced controversy in 2009 when he was ordered to pay $300,000 to the Ontario Securities Commission for violating Ontario securities law while serving as the chief financial officer at Biovail, a pharmaceutical company.

April Fools’ Day Joke Becomes Reality

Interestingly, Brian Crombie initially announced his mayoral run as an April Fools’ Day prank earlier this month. However, his official registration indicates that he is serious about entering the political fray and vying for leadership in Mississauga.

The byelection, scheduled for June 10, was triggered by Bonnie Crombie’s resignation earlier this year following her successful bid for leadership of the Ontario Liberal Party. Several high-profile candidates have already joined the race, including former and current city councillors Carolyn Parrish, Dipika Damerla, Alvin Tedjo, and Stephen Dasko.

A Fresh Perspective on City Leadership

Crombie is positioning himself as a fresh alternative to candidates with direct ties to city council. He believes that bringing in an outsider with business acumen and strategic leadership is crucial for Mississauga’s future.

“I am not on council, like the four leading candidates, and I think that to bring change to city hall and a new vision to our city, we need serious people and a fresh new start.”

Other notable contenders include Peter McCallion, son of the late Hazel McCallion (Mississauga’s legendary former mayor), as well as past mayoral candidates George Tavares and David Shaw.

Nominations for the mayoral race close on April 26, leaving a limited window for additional candidates to enter.

Who Is Brian Crombie? Personal Life & Relationship with Bonnie Crombie

Beyond his political aspirations, many are curious about Brian Crombie’s personal life, especially his past relationship with Bonnie Crombie. The couple, who have since separated, share three children and have continued to co-parent while pursuing their individual careers.

With an MBA from Northwestern University’s Kellogg School of Management, Brian Crombie has made a name for himself in business, philanthropy, and community leadership. Despite past controversies, he remains an influential figure in Mississauga’s political and business landscape.
